**Key Ceremony Checklist — Item 7: Tilefetch Prefetcher Signing Key**

Confirm both custodians from the Harrowgate support rotation are present before opening the Tilefetch signing envelope. This key signs manifests for the map-tile prefetcher; without it, regional caches in the Veldt cluster reject new tile bundles. Verify the tamper seal number matches the ledger entry, then initialize the signing module. When the module prompts for initialization, enter the recovery passphrase below.

unlock words, kajeg-fahif: holmir-casael-novdor

## Fix cron drift in Tarnwick's scheduler pool

This PR addresses the drift we traced over the past two weeks: jobs on the Haldora pool fired up to 90 seconds late because tick alignment used wall-clock time and ignored NTP step corrections. I switched the scheduler to a monotonic clock with periodic re-anchoring, and added jitter bounds so rescheduled jobs don't stampede. Please review the re-anchor logic carefully before merging. The tuning constants applied in this change are as follows.

tuning table, yajog-yahof:
BUDGETS = {
    "lamvan": 303,
    "wenox": 460,
    "fenvan": 525,
}

## Data Stores: Password Reset Flow

The Bramblegate password reset revamp (Q3) replaced emailed plaintext tokens with single-use hashed tokens stored in the `auth_resets` table. Tokens expire after 15 minutes and are deleted on use or expiry by a sweeper job running every five minutes. Rate limiting is enforced per account, not per IP, in the `reset_attempts` table. Both tables live in the auth database, separate from the main application store. Maintainers can reach it with the following connection string.

replica DSN, yahaf-yagaf: mongodb://tamath_svc:a2netSk3RZMuTj@db-d084.novacsoft.internal:5432/ralmir